В процессорном развитии смартфоны повторяют путь ПК

Смартфоны становятся все мощнее, но и потребности пользователей растут тоже, отмечает обозреватель NetworkWorld. Текущее поколение устройств, включая наиболее производительные решения вроде Apple iPhone 4 или Samsung Galaxy S, способно воспроизводить и вести захват видео в разрешении 720p и комплектуется одноядерным процессором с частотой 1 ГГц, в то время как будущие гаджеты получат двухъядерные чипы и покорят видео в разрешении 1080p.

Пока производители телефонов официально не анонсировали устройств с двухъядерными процессорами, но разработчики соответствующих чипов готовы удовлетворить спрос на многоядерные решения. Qualcomm уже начала поставки двухъядерного процессора Snapdragon MSM8660 (1,2 ГГц), а позже в этом году появится его более производительная модель QSD8672 (1,5 ГГц). Texas Instruments планирует выпустить свое решение OMAP4430 (1 ГГц, ядро — ARM Cortex-A9) позже в этом году, но в коммерческих устройствах оно появится лишь в следующем году.

В качестве примера все возрастающих требований к вычислительной мощности смартфонов главный аналитик Insight 64 Натан Бруквуд (Nathan Brookwood) приводит функцию FaceTime в iPhone 4. В данном случае требуется немало производительности для захвата и передачи видео в режиме реального времени и с высокой частотой кадров, при этом еще необходимо формировать картинку в картинке. В будущем увеличится разрешение передаваемого видео, что повлечет за собой и повышенную нагрузку на процессор. Это лишь один пример того, что наращивать производительность смартфонов потребуется уже в ближайший год.

Один из альтернативных вариантов увеличения скорости устройств заключается в повышении частоты одноядерного процессора, но он не очень выгоден в плане потребления энергии и, как результат, эффективности охлаждения микросхемы в компактном мобильном гаджете. Намного удобнее использовать два ядра с более низкой частотой работы. Тем не менее и в таком случае не все просто, сообщает NetworkWorld. TI и Qualcomm разработали специальные алгоритмы эффективного управления процессорами в зависимости от нагрузки. Среди используемых особенностей стоит выделить возможность динамически включать и отключать ядра и изменять частоту их работы в зависимости от исполняемого приложения. В целом же развитие мобильных чипов повторяет путь процессоров в персональных компьютерах, которые довольно давно уже перешли на многоядерную архитектуру. Первой такой подход применила IBM в серверных процессорах Power4, а позже подключились Intel и AMD, сделав многоядерные чипы массовыми и доступными в потребительском секторе.